    Collected the M3P! First impressions and a few questions

    Also remember that CCS in many ways is a Type 2 connector, it just has an extra two pins at the bottom. It doesn’t really feel like two different options once you get the car. The vast majority of AC chargers are Type 2 and the vast majority of DC chargers are CCS. You just plug in and go...

    Cabin overheat protection

    It is the interior temprature which controls whether it comes on. In my experience it comes on if internal temperatures rise above 38C and maintains that temperature. The car easily gets to 40C on the inside even with modest (low 20s) sunshine in the UK.
